What is the importance of prenatal motility: cognitive development. Myogenic movements (pathway to development of neurogenic movement) Neurogenic movements (enables foetus to change position in utero, enables foetus to execute higher order functions: musculoskeletal development. Paralysis study (drachman & sokoloff, 1966) resulted in muscle atrophy and joint malformations. Movement enables muscles and joint to develop properly. Sperm and eggs each carry 23 chromosomes. Chromosomes carry genetic material that drive development. Gene defect may be present at conception or may be altered during pregnancy - dif cult to distinguish. Prior to 1990, study of genetics was limited. In 1990, the human genome project commenced - aim of determining what sections of dna (genes) responsible for certain conditions.
